【Nyonya Cuisine】Nyonya Chang / Nyonya Bamboo-Leaf Rice Dumplings 娘惹粽
The Dragon Boat Festival is just around the corner, falling on the 25th of June, 2020, this year. Dragon Boat Festival or Duanwu Jie (端午節), is celebrated on the 5th day of the fifth month on the Lunar calendar every year. Eating the sticky rice dumplings wrapped in bamboo leaves (Zongzi 粽子 in Mandarin, Chang 粽 in Hokkien dialet) is the traditional practice on this day. So I thought I would gather together some cooking videos I found on the net here for references. I will start with the Nyonya version as I am also thinking of doing a series of Nyonya cuisine posts in the future. Nyonya rice dumplings are a variation of the traditional Chinese rice dumplings originated by the Nyonyas (descendants of Chinese and Malay intermarriages) in Malaysia and Singapore.

Stefanie Sun’s 20th Anniversary Impromptu Live Stream 孫燕姿出道20週年驚喜線上直播
Singaporean singer, Stefanie Sun (孫燕姿), surprised her fans with an impromptu Facebook live concert yesterday (June 9), 9th of June was the day she launched her first album back in 2000. She was on social media asking her fans how to commemorate the anniversary during the day. Her fans requested a concert, and around 8pm that night, she went live online with a mini concert.
